In Episode 51 of Scoreboard, Chris Titley chats with Mitch Dyer—the voice of Australian athletics in 2025—about calling his way into the nation’s sporting conversation, from viral catchphrases to life-changing commentary boxes.

Mitch shares how he went from a distance-running string bean to a carpenter, to a broadcaster chasing races across Europe and sleeping in airports to get his shot.

He opens up about working with Bruce McAvaney, learning the art of the perfect call, and the nerves (and instinct) behind “Gout of this world”.

From growing up in a family of walkers to standing in a Paris Olympic stadium realising he’d built a life he never saw coming, Mitch reflects on the power of preparation, persistence, and just being yourself—even when the mic’s live and the clock’s ticking.
